Course structure

• Introduction to Copyright Law in Sports
• Sports Licensing Agreements and Contracts
• Digital Rights Management in Sports
• Intellectual Property Rights Enforcement in Sports
• Case Studies in Sports Copyright Infringement
• Anti-Piracy Strategies for Sports Content
• Sports Trademarks and Brand Protection
• International Copyright Issues in Sports
• Legal Remedies for Copyright Violations in Sports
